Я пытаюсь загрузить данные профиля с помощью реактивной базы редукта, но она не работает.
Это моя функция для создания нового пользователя:
firebase.createUser({ email, password }, { firstName, lastName })
Это как я настраиваю свой магазин:
const rootReducer = combineReducers({
auth: authReducer,
firestore: firestoreReducer,
firebase: firebaseReducer
})
const store = createStore(
rootReducer,
compose(
applyMiddleware(thunk.withExtraArgument({ getFirebase, getFirestore })),
reduxFirestore(firebase, rrfConfig)
)
)
Где fbConfig - это конфигурация из firebase, а rrConfig:
const rrfConfig = { userProfile: 'users', useFirestoreForProfile: true }
После этого я рендерим его:
<Provider store={store}>
<ReactReduxFirebaseProvider
firebase={firebase}
config={rrfConfig}
dispatch={store.dispatch}
createFirestoreInstance={createFirestoreInstance}
>
<HashRouter>
<App/>
</HashRouter>
</ReactReduxFirebaseProvider>
</Provider>
Что может быть не так? Имя и фамилия в базе данных пожарного магазина, но они не загружаются.